ALBERTA                                                        West Edmonton Mall By Matthew

LOCATION One of 10 provinces in Canada ( North America) Fourth largest province in Canada Alberta is found between British Columbia and Saskatchewan

CAPITOL CITY Population 863,000 Home to 32,800 aboriginal people 1st people were Athapaskans

Attractions Alberta has the Calgary Stampede every July One of Alberta’s greatest attractions is the Northern lights. Northern Lights

Natural Resources Oil, Natural gas and coal The main producer of coal in all of Canada Sells oil, natural gas and coal to other provinces

History 1st Peoples: Slavey, Chipewyan, Beaver, Cree, Sarcee and Blackfoot Alberta built a legislative building in 1920

Fast Facts The Wild Rose is the national flower of Alberta Alberta has one of the largest dinosaur museums Alberta has the biggest mall in all of Canada – The West Edmonton Mall European explorers came to Alberta in 1754 Population 2,800,000
